Pearls, One of the world’s most sought after natural wonder

The love affair with pearls began when the first coastal fish-eater opened an oyster and found this wondrous gem. Over the millennia, because natural pearls were so rare, they became the most valued and sought after gem. In historical documents, it is written that to show the Romans Egyptian wealth, Cleopatra dissolved a pearl in a glass of wine for Marc Antony valued today at approximately 5million dollars

Several myths: The Greeks believed pearls were the goddess Aphrodite’s tears of joy. Egyptians associated them with healing and life. The Incas and Aztecs cherished pearls for their beauty and magical powers and the Chinese still use powdered pearls in creams to retain their youth. 

In the Roman and British Empires only rulers and very wealthy were allowed to wear pearls. Both the Holy Bible and the Koran revere pearls. In the Holy Bible Saint Peter greets at the “Pearly Gates” while in the Koran Krishna gives his daughter a pearl on her wedding day.

The greatest treasure Columbus brought back to Europe from the New World were pearls. Pearls were so abundant in the Americas they were soon known as “The Land where Pearls came from”.

Pearls were found in abundance in Freshwater Mussels along the Mississippi and Ohio River Basins. They were treasured in Europe until ravenous harvesting depleted the oyster beds. In the Caribbean island of Margarita (Spanish word for pearl), off the coast of Venezuela , pearls were so over harvested in the early 1500s that the oyster beds have never been able to recover.

 All throughout history pearls were cherished by all but only available to the most wealthy. Now, thanks to Kokichi Mikimoto and several of his contemporaries, we have access to cultured saltwater and freshwater  pearls that rival the quality of naturally occurring pearls. Freshwater pearls are comprised mostly of nacre (the material that gives a pearl it’s deep, rich, lustrous coating) because they are cultivated by introducing only tiny starting nucleus . Although, there are freshwater pearls so similar to saltwater pearls that they cannot be differentiated by the naked eye the interesting shapes and colors of freshwater pearls also lend themselves well to the imagination of many jewelry designers.
